A hat is a perfect rainy day, or even snowy day, accessory! I love my that black hat is not too floppy and has a rounded style. It’s made out of black wool so it keeps me warm on winter days like today while protecting my face and hair from the rain! I paired my cool hat with a super comfy and classic white long sleeve waffle shirt from Old Navy and a big kimono style sweater from Missguided. The sweater is perfect for crisp fall days and can even work as a jacket. It feels like I’m wearing a big blanket! I finished my look with a trendy black choker with a cool gold charm to make everything look a little more polished.

Of course leggings are a must on cold and rainy days because they keep you warm and are easy to slip into a great pair of rain boots that keep your feet warm and dry. My boots are a Tommy Hilfiger play on combat style boots. They’re not as high as traditional rain boots and even have laces! I fell in love with these boots when I saw them a few years ago and they’ve been with me through most rain storms over the last four years at college! If it was a little colder (or if it was snowing!) I would’ve paired my look with warm camp socks or even my higher rain boots with fleece inserts.
